About
> Is it possible to rape one's own wife? Can one be divorced in some states but > not in others? Is adultery always a grounds for divorce? Are married > couples really free in their own beds? > > So complex are our laws governing sex and marriage, that too often such > questions can only be answered by a court of law; and a decision in one > state can be negated by the courts in another. Accordingly, a large portion > of our population could be prosecuted and convicted by obscure laws that no > longer fit our twentieth-century manners and mores. > > Here is a comprehensive study of our laws as they relate to sex, with > illuminating case histories which show the pitfalls that can trap the > unenlightened.
